Federal companies are working with left-wing organizations to show their discipline places of work across the nation into so-called ‘get out the vote’ facilities, together with a concentrate on reversing guidelines or statutes in states that forestall convicted felons from voting.

The initiative stems from an govt order signed in March 2021, simply weeks after he took workplace. EO 14019 is “often referred to by critics as ‘Bidenbucks,’ which alludes to ‘Zuckerbucks,’ the approximately $400 million from Facebook founder Mark Zuckerberg widely alleged to have been funneled through left-leaning nonprofits to turn out the Democratic vote in the 2020 presidential election,” Just the News reported.

Left-wing organizations collaborated with the Department of Justice to plan methods for implementing Biden’s govt order to make the most of the federal authorities for voter registration.

This collaboration commenced following help from a type of teams to the Biden administration in crafting the manager order.

The order states: “The head of each agency shall evaluate ways in which the agency can, as appropriate and consistent with applicable law, promote voter registration and voter participation,” together with “soliciting and facilitating approved, nonpartisan third-party organizations and state officials to provide voter registration services on agency premises.”

Similar to “Bidenbucks,” “Zuckerbucks” got here to note when the Center for Tech and Civic Life (CTCL) poured about $350 million into native election places of work managing the 2020 election, with a lot of the funds donated to the nonprofit by Zuckerberg. The nonprofit has claimed its 2020 election grants—colloquially generally known as “Zuckerbucks” — have been allotted with out partisan choice to make voting safer amid the pandemic.

However, a House Republican investigation discovered that lower than 1% of the funds have been spent on private protecting tools. Most of the funds have been targeted on get-out-the-vote efforts and registrations in areas closely leaning [toward] Democratic candidates. 

Controversy ensued following revelations concerning the disproportionate quantity of personal funding directed in the direction of Democratic districts, with claims that the imbalance influenced the result of the 2020 election in Biden’s favor. According to the Capital Research Center, 28 states have both restricted or prohibited using personal funds to finance elections, whereas 12 counties have additionally imposed restrictions or bans on such funds.

Public data obtained by the Heritage Foundation’s Oversight Project reveal that the Department of Justice (DOJ) held a “listening session” in July 2021 with numerous non-governmental organizations (NGOs) to debate the implementation of “Bidenbucks,” the outlet’s report famous additional.

Heritage found that each one contributors from NGOs, whose political donations or celebration affiliation might be recognized, have been Democrats aside from one Green Party member.

Just the News listed a number of of the collaborating NGOs: AFL-CIO, AFSCME; The American Civil Liberties Union; The Anti-Defamation League; Black Voters Matter; Brennan Center for Justice at NYU; Common Cause; Democracy Fund; Demos; End Citizens United/Let America Vote; The Fair Elections Center; Fair Fight Action; FairVote; Lawyers’ Committee for Civil Rights; The Leadership Conference on Civil and Human Rights; The Mexican American Defense and Education Fund (MALDEF); NAACP; National Education Association; National Urban League; Native American Rights Fund, League of Women Voters; Open Society Policy Center; and The Southern Poverty Law Center.

The Leadership Conference on Civil and Human Rights, a coalition comprising 240 left-wing non-governmental organizations (NGOs), contains the Lawyers’ Committee for Civil Rights, which Assistant Attorney General for the Civil Rights Division Kristen Clarke led earlier than assuming her present place within the Biden administration.

The public data contained notes from the DOJ’s listening session with the non-governmental organizations (NGOs), highlighting one of many main issues: guaranteeing that jail inmates are registered to vote and discussing methods to revive voting rights for felons.

One of the NGOs, Demos, printed a doc on Dec. 3, 2020, titled, “Executive Action to Advance Democracy: What the Biden-Harris Administration and the Agencies Can Do to Build a More Inclusive Democracy.”

It “lays out a series of executive actions the new administration can take in partnership with federal agencies to help ensure the integrity of our elections and strengthen opportunities for civic participation for all Americans, particularly black and brown Americans.”

Included within the plan, per Just the News:

1. Direct federal companies to offer voter registration companies.

2. Strengthen the Department of Justice’s enforcement of and steerage on voting rights statutes.

3. Support the Election Assistance Commission in its efforts to strengthen entry to voting and voter registration.

4. Create an Office of Democracy and Civic Innovation inside the White House.

5. Strengthen the U.S. Postal Service’s skill to ship election mail and different vital mail to all Americans.

6. Ensure entry to Federal Bureau of Prison knowledge wanted to finish prison-based gerrymandering.
